
Buffalo City sits surrounded by the intricate wetlands of Dare County, where the Milltail Creek drainage network meets the wide expanse of the Alligator River. This 1953 survey, photo-inspected in 1980, reveals a landscape defined by water and low-lying topography, featuring a complex system of guts and bays like Sandy Ridge Gut and Boat Bay. The presence of Ruins and Piling near the creek suggest a history of human activity and industry along these waterways, while the Lookout Tower near East Lake provides a terrestrial landmark in the marshy terrain.
